ECOWAS Court orders Nigeria to release man detained for 16yrs without trial

The Economic Community of West African States (ECOWAS) Court has ordered the Federal Government of Nigeria to release a Nigerian businessman, Moses Abiodun, who has been in detention since 2009 without trial. Ex-militants in Ondo protest exclusion from Amnesty Programme

…Beg President Tinubu to Intervene By Dayo Johnson, Akure Ex-militants from the oil-rich Ilaje Local Government Area of Ondo State have protested their exclusion from the Federal Government’s Amnesty Programme since 2017.
